15659287
0xe8230bb84ef6951c6bdce9942959130221840b6a8607c8f1f90df59cb0497651
Transactions0
Height15659287
Confirmations13823
Timestamp1 day 3 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x5d1e8c7bd044da2e
Bits
Difficulty0x2727a169